Enzymatic synthesis is suitable for the synthesis of small peptides, for example dipeptides and tripeptides, and enzymatically synthesized peptides are productively applied for that production of food additives, prescribed drugs, and agrochemicals. Fermentation is perfectly-documented being an eco-welcoming strategy for developing bioactive peptides, for instance from the manufacture of cyclosporine214. Recombinant DNA technology enables the creation of peptides and proteins with described sequences and homogeneity. This method is especially helpful for production prolonged or complex peptides with various disulfide bonds, which can normally be tricky to synthesize chemically. Human insulin and growth hormone are consultant samples of the numerous out there peptide medicine made utilizing recombinant DNA technology. Moreover, recombinant DNA technology is usually blended with genetic code growth and other novel systems to introduce wished-for useful teams into your molecules by means of the incorporation of unnatural amino acids, as talked over beneath. Semi-synthesis gives a flexible strategy for generating significant bioactive polypeptides by linking synthetic peptides and recombinant DNA-expressed peptides215–217, which is a very practical method when many synthetic modifications are needed.

The rational layout of peptides involves computer-assisted bioinformatics technology according to the settled crystal framework of the target PPIs. Bioinformatic and computational analysis in the PPI binding interface allows the critical amino acids on the surface of the two interacting proteins to generally be identified. These important amino acids add the major Gibbs Power from the PPIs and are commonly known as “hotspots”86,87. Hotspots may be a constant fragment from the protein or dispersed residues on distinctive secondary structures from the protein. The design of peptide modulators for PPIs relies on these hotspots, possibly straight utilizing the continuous fragment or using a technique to backlink the dispersed residues as initial sequences88.
